PostPosted: Tue Dec 07, 2004 12:30 pm    Post subject: Forum Languages Reply with quote

I have said in my profile that my forum language is English. How can I tell Forums to display only topics which are written in English? That would save a lot of scanning and reduce the number of pages displayed after a search.
